Before everybody starts investing too heavily in the list of “can’t-miss” quarterback prospects that should be available in next spring’s NFL draft, let’s take a look at how the much-ballyhooed draft class of 2021 combined to fare on Sunday. Trevor Lawrence, Zach Wilson, and Mac Jones were a combined 55 of 88, throwing for an average of 206 yards with no touchdowns and four interceptions.
In football terms, yuck.
The No. 1 pick from that class, Jacksonville’s Lawrence, was brutal against the San Francisco 49ers, a 34-3 shellacking during which Lawrence was sacked five times.
